本頁列出影響 enlightenment imlib2 的已公開 CVE 漏洞(透過 NVD CPE 關聯)。每列包含嚴重程度評分、摘要與發布日期,便於識別與分析安全議題。
| CVE | 摘要 | 來源 | 最高 CVSS | EPSS % | 公開時間 | 更新時間 |
|---|---|---|---|---|---|---|
| CVE-2024-25450 | imlib2 v1.9.1 was discovered to mishandle memory allocation in the function init_imlib_fonts(). | [email protected] | 8.8 | 0.66% | 2024-02-09 | 2026-06-17 |
| CVE-2024-25448 | An issue in the imlib_free_image_and_decache function of imlib2 v1.9.1 allows attackers to cause a heap buffer overflow via parsing a crafted image. | [email protected] | 8.8 | 0.72% | 2024-02-09 | 2026-06-17 |
| CVE-2024-25447 | An issue in the imlib_load_image_with_error_return function of imlib2 v1.9.1 allows attackers to cause a heap buffer overflow via parsing a crafted image. | [email protected] | 8.8 | 0.69% | 2024-02-09 | 2026-06-17 |
| CVE-2020-12761 | modules/loaders/loader_ico.c in imlib2 1.6.0 has an integer overflow (with resultant invalid memory allocations and out-of-bounds reads) via an icon with many colors in its color map. | [email protected] | 9.1 | 1.59% | 2020-05-09 | 2026-06-16 |
| CVE-2016-4024 | Integer overflow in imlib2 before 1.4.9 on 32-bit platforms allows remote attackers to execute arbitrary code via large dimensions in an image, which triggers an out-of-bounds heap memory write operation. | [email protected] | 9.8 | 5.84% | 2016-05-13 | 2026-06-16 |
| CVE-2016-3994 | The GIF loader in imlib2 before 1.4.9 allows remote attackers to cause a denial of service (application crash) or obtain sensitive information via a crafted image, which triggers an out-of-bounds read. | [email protected] | 8.2 | 2.78% | 2016-05-13 | 2026-06-16 |
| CVE-2016-3993 | Off-by-one error in the __imlib_MergeUpdate function in lib/updates.c in imlib2 before 1.4.9 allows remote attackers to cause a denial of service (out-of-bounds read and application crash) via crafted coordinates. | [email protected] | 7.5 | 2.92% | 2016-05-13 | 2026-06-16 |
| CVE-2014-9771 | Integer overflow in imlib2 before 1.4.7 allows remote attackers to cause a denial of service (memory consumption or application crash) via a crafted image, which triggers an invalid read operation. | [email protected] | 7.5 | 2.71% | 2016-05-13 | 2026-06-16 |
| CVE-2014-9764 | imlib2 before 1.4.7 allows remote attackers to cause a denial of service (segmentation fault) via a crafted GIF file. | [email protected] | 7.5 | 2.71% | 2016-05-13 | 2026-06-16 |
| CVE-2014-9763 | imlib2 before 1.4.7 allows remote attackers to cause a denial of service (divide-by-zero error and application crash) via a crafted PNM file. | [email protected] | 7.5 | 2.71% | 2016-05-13 | 2026-06-16 |
| CVE-2014-9762 | imlib2 before 1.4.7 allows remote attackers to cause a denial of service (segmentation fault) via a GIF image without a colormap. | [email protected] | 7.5 | 2.71% | 2016-05-13 | 2026-06-16 |
| CVE-2011-5326 | imlib2 before 1.4.9 allows remote attackers to cause a denial of service (divide-by-zero error and application crash) by drawing a 2x1 ellipse. | [email protected] | 7.5 | 2.92% | 2016-05-13 | 2026-06-16 |
| CVE-2010-0991 | Multiple heap-based buffer overflows in imlib2 1.4.3 allow context-dependent attackers to execute arbitrary code via a crafted (1) ARGB, (2) XPM, or (3) BMP file, related to the IMAGE_DIMENSIONS_OK macro in lib/image.h. | [email protected] | 6.8 | 1.96% | 2010-04-22 | 2026-06-16 |
| CVE-2008-6079 | imlib2 before 1.4.2 allows context-dependent attackers to have an unspecified impact via a crafted (1) ARGB, (2) BMP, (3) JPEG, (4) LBM, (5) PNM, (6) TGA, or (7) XPM file, related to "several heap and stack based buffer overflows - partly due to integer overflows." | [email protected] | 10.0 | 2.82% | 2009-02-06 | 2026-06-16 |
| CVE-2008-5187 | The load function in the XPM loader for imlib2 1.4.2, and possibly other versions, allows attackers to cause a denial of service (crash) and possibly execute arbitrary code via a crafted XPM file that triggers a "pointer arithmetic error" and a heap-based buffer overflow, a different vulnerability than CVE-2008-2426. | [email protected] | 7.5 | 3.64% | 2008-11-20 | 2026-06-16 |
| CVE-2006-4809 | Stack-based buffer overflow in loader_pnm.c in imlib2 before 1.2.1, and possibly other versions, allows user-assisted remote attackers to cause a denial of service (crash) and possibly execute arbitrary code via a crafted PNM image. | [email protected] | 5.1 | 4.10% | 2006-11-06 | 2026-06-16 |
| CVE-2006-4808 | Heap-based buffer overflow in loader_tga.c in imlib2 before 1.2.1, and possibly other versions, allows user-assisted remote attackers to cause a denial of service (crash) and possibly execute arbitrary code via a crafted TGA image. | [email protected] | 2.6 | 4.10% | 2006-11-06 | 2026-06-16 |
| CVE-2006-4807 | loader_tga.c in imlib2 before 1.2.1, and possibly other versions, allows user-assisted remote attackers to cause a denial of service (crash) via a crafted TGA image that triggers an out-of-bounds memory read, a different issue than CVE-2006-4808. | [email protected] | 2.6 | 2.02% | 2006-11-06 | 2026-06-16 |
| CVE-2006-4806 | Multiple integer overflows in imlib2 allow user-assisted remote attackers to cause a denial of service (crash) and possibly execute arbitrary code via a crafted (1) ARGB (loader_argb.c), (2) PNG (loader_png.c), (3) LBM (loader_lbm.c), (4) JPEG (loader_jpeg.c), or (5) TIFF (loader_tiff.c) images. | [email protected] | 5.1 | 4.17% | 2006-11-06 | 2026-06-16 |
| CVE-2004-0817 | Multiple heap-based buffer overflows in the imlib BMP image handler allow remote attackers to execute arbitrary code via a crafted BMP file. | [email protected] | 7.5 | 4.87% | 2004-12-31 | 2026-06-16 |
